Research article

INTEGRATION OF CO-ALU AND MULTIPLIER WITH 8-BIT CONTROLLER USING VHDL AND RECONFIGURABLE HARDWARE

Tanaji M Dudhane*, T. Ravi

Online First: December 22, 2022


The 8-bit microcontroller with their growing demand in different areas of applications as medical, consumer appliances, smart metering, ATMs, vending machines, with small modifications in the hardware architecture, they are performing efficiently in terms of operation throughput and power consumption. This paper presents the integration of 16-bit co-operative ALU and 8-bit multiplier to 8-bit controller using VHDL. The goal of this research was to improve the computability of the 8-bit controller by creating a VHDL model with C-ALU and multiplier. This research presents a novel implementation of hybrid 8-bit controller design, which can process mixed size data operations efficiently by utilizing multiple ALUs in single data path. For the implementation of 8-bit controller with C-ALU and multiplier, the selected hardware platform is the SPARTAN-7 device family XC7K160T-3FBG676E FPGA. Maximum clock frequency achieved on the selected device is 31.15 MHz rather than 20 MHz of the original controller. The average performance 71% is improved in multi-byte operational cases.

Keywords

ATMS; Co-Operative ALU; VHDL; ALU; FPGA